Flat ro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a flat roof’s condition to identify potential issues before they develop into costly problems. Skilled service providers examine the roof’s surface, edges, drainage systems, and flashing to detect signs of wear, damage, or deterioration. This process often includes checking for cracks, blisters, pooling water, or areas where the roofing material may be compromised. Regular inspections help homeowners maintain the integrity of their flat roofs and ensure that any problems are caught early, potentially preventing leaks or structural damage.
One of the primary benefits of flat roof inspections is diagnosing issues that may not be immediately visible. Over time, flat roofs can develop small cracks, punctures, or areas of ponding water that weaken the roof’s structure. Without proper maintenance, these problems can lead to leaks, mold growth, or even roof failure. Inspection services help identify these issues early, allowing property owners to address them with repairs or maintenance before they escalate into more serious and expensive repairs.

Why should I get a flat roof inspected? Regular inspections can help identify potential issues early, preventing costly repairs and ensuring the roof remains in good condition.
What signs indicate a flat roof needs an inspection? Visible ponding water, cracks, blistering, or debris accumulation are common signs that a flat roof may require professional assessment.
How often should flat roof inspections be performed? It is recommended to have flat roofs inspected at least once a year and after severe weather events to catch any damage early.
What do local contractors look for during a flat roof inspection? Inspectors check for membrane damage, pooling water, seam integrity, and signs of wear or deterioration that could lead to leaks.
Can a flat roof inspection help extend the roof's lifespan? Yes, regular inspections can help detect issues early, allowing for timely repairs that can prolong the roof’s overall lifespan.
